import org.junit.jupiter.api.Test;
import org.junit.jupiter.params.ParameterizedTest;
import org.junit.jupiter.params.provider.ValueSource;
import java.net.http.HttpRequest;
import java.util.concurrent.BlockingQueue;
import java.util.concurrent.LinkedBlockingQueue;
import static org.junit.jupiter.api.Assertions.assertEquals;
import static org.junit.jupiter.api.Assertions.assertThrows;
import static org.junit.jupiter.api.Assertions.assertTrue;
/*
* @test
* @bug 8364733
* @summary Verify all specified `HttpRequest.BodyPublishers::fromPublisher` behavior
* @build RecordingSubscriber
* @run junit FromPublisherTest
*/
class FromPublisherTest {
@Test
void testNullPublisher() {
assertThrows(NullPointerException.class, () -> HttpRequest.BodyPublishers.fromPublisher(null));
assertThrows(NullPointerException.class, () -> HttpRequest.BodyPublishers.fromPublisher(null, 1));
}
@ParameterizedTest
@ValueSource(longs = {0L, -1L, Long.MIN_VALUE})
void testInvalidContentLength(long contentLength) {
IllegalArgumentException exception = assertThrows(
IllegalArgumentException.class,
() -> HttpRequest.BodyPublishers.fromPublisher(null, contentLength));
String exceptionMessage = exception.getMessage();
assertTrue(
exceptionMessage.contains("non-positive contentLength"),
"Unexpected exception message: " + exceptionMessage);
}
@ParameterizedTest
@ValueSource(longs = {1, 2, 3, 4})
void testValidContentLength(long contentLength) {
HttpRequest.BodyPublisher publisher =
HttpRequest.BodyPublishers.fromPublisher(HttpRequest.BodyPublishers.noBody(), contentLength);
assertEquals(contentLength, publisher.contentLength());
}
@Test
void testNoContentLength() {
HttpRequest.BodyPublisher publisher =
HttpRequest.BodyPublishers.fromPublisher(HttpRequest.BodyPublishers.noBody());
assertEquals(-1, publisher.contentLength());
}
@Test
void testNullSubscriber() {
HttpRequest.BodyPublisher publisher =
HttpRequest.BodyPublishers.fromPublisher(HttpRequest.BodyPublishers.noBody());
assertThrows(NullPointerException.class, () -> publisher.subscribe(null));
}
@Test
void testDelegation() throws InterruptedException {
BlockingQueue<Object> publisherInvocations = new LinkedBlockingQueue<>();
HttpRequest.BodyPublisher publisher = HttpRequest.BodyPublishers.fromPublisher(subscriber -> {
publisherInvocations.add("subscribe");
publisherInvocations.add(subscriber);
});
RecordingSubscriber subscriber = new RecordingSubscriber();
publisher.subscribe(subscriber);
assertEquals("subscribe", publisherInvocations.take());
assertEquals(subscriber, publisherInvocations.take());
assertTrue(subscriber.invocations.isEmpty());
}
}
